To create hyperbolas, the double-napped cone must be sliced by a plane that intersects both naps of the cone.That is, the angle of the … bateria gw metalWeb7 sep. 2024 · If the plane is perpendicular to the axis of revolution, the conic section is a circle. If the plane intersects one nappe at an angle to the axis (other than 90°), then the conic section is an ellipse. Figure 11.5.2: The four conic sections.
